Ukraine has commenced the mass production of a new long-range kamikaze drone, akin to the Shahed, marking a significant advancement in the country's defense capabilities.

Oleksandr Kamyshin, the Head of the Ministry for Strategic Industries of Ukraine, made this announcement during a recent press conference.

Kamyshin highlighted that these developments have been in the pipeline since 2016 but hadn't been actualized until now. "We have kickstarted the series production of these drones. Presently, we are manufacturing dozens of them, and the plan is to ramp up significantly.

By next year, the Armed Forces could be equipped with over a thousand drones capable of covering distances exceeding 1000 kilometers," Kamyshin stated.

This move by Ukraine signals a robust response to the ongoing conflict and demonstrates the nation's resilience and innovation in military technology. The defense industry's capability to produce such a significant number of kamikaze drones underlines the strategic shift in Ukraine's approach to warfare.

In addition to the long-range kamikaze drones, Kamyshin also affirmed President Volodymyr Zelenskyy's earlier statement regarding the production of a million FPV drones next year.

This production scale is set to provide a substantial boost to Ukraine's aerial combat and reconnaissance capabilities.
